In preparation for admission to universities in the USA, students should compile a checklist of essential documents from their current or former educational institutions. This includes transcripts and certificates to demonstrate academic qualifications. Furthermore, applicants must furnish proof of proficiency in English by presenting scores from internationally recognized language tests like IELTS, TOEFL, PTE, or Duolingo. These documents play a crucial role in the application process, ensuring that students meet the required standards for admission and academic success in American universities.
In the USA, universities typically follow a similar schedule with admission periods for fall, spring, and sometimes summer terms. To ensure a smooth process, students are advised to apply approximately 6-12 months before their intended start date, allowing ample time for visa processing and other arrangements. Applications can be submitted directly through the university's online portal or via the Common Application for multiple institutions. Upon receiving an acceptance letter from the university, students in the USA are typically required to confirm their enrollment and secure their spot by submitting either a deposit fee or the first semester's tuition payment. Once this initial payment is made, students may need to complete additional financial documentation as part of their visa application process. This may include demonstrating proof of funds for living expenses and educational costs.
